Hi there, a few years ago I was looking for my grandfather's grave in the St Swithins part,  I found an address and phone no which proved extremely useful. the address is  - Crematorium and Cemetaries general enquiries, Washingborough Road, Lincoln, sorry I do not have a post code, Tel 873646. The person I spoke to was extremely helpful and efficient and gave me directions to the grave  and the plot no and there was no mention of a  payment,  he was more tham  happy to help.  Hope this will help. There are certainly LFHS transcriptions of the MI's at the central library in Lincoln, i have used them myself several times but as mentioned before the reference numbers are different to the plot numbers.

The main benefit of the MI's (dor me anyway) has been to point me in the right direction for a few death dates, eg the George Chambers mentioned before.

The MI lists were compiled a few years ago (late 1970's) and show what appears on the headstone, due to the time they were completed several stones are now missing or ilegible.

The George Chambers headstone for instance is no longer there but crucially it mentioned his age, that tallied with the Cemetery Register result (which also gave his residence) and i was able to order the certificate and prove he was my grt g/f. Add in the B793 George Chambers + B794 reference for George Graby and it meant i could locate the plot which would otherwise be unmarked and almost impossible to find.

It tied up a nice little story for the two Georges' were not only b-i-l to each other but lived in the same houses/streets for at least forty years and were witnesses on certificates etc for each other.
